Table of ContentsAbout the Authors List of Figures Purpose and Value of this Book Introduction. 1: Cultural Competence: A Drop of Ink in a Glass of Water. 2: The Imperativeness of Culture in Cultural Competence. 3: Castling: Cultural Competence as a Strategic Differentiator. 4: The Satya Nadella Case for Cultural Competence. 5: The Cultural Competence Index (CCI) Measurement Matrix. 6: Case Study Example Explanations of The CCI Construct Elements. 7: Institutionalizing Cultural Competence. 8: Future Challenges and Opportunities for Cultural Competence. Epilogue. BibliographyReviewsAuthor InformationSteyn Heckroodt, PhD, is a practitioner, professor, and thought leader in leadership and strategy, Heckroodt provides a wealth of experience and expertise when engaging with global business leaders in the boardroom, classroom, on the field, and in the cloud. Leveraging on his experience in over 50 countries, consulting for a myriad of organizations, and engaging with tumultuous, culturally different workforces, Heckroodt focuses on diversity as the key to intrinsic strategic competitiveness for organizations, hence Cultural Competence. Waddah S. Ghanem Al Hashmi, BEng (Hons), MBA, MSc, DBA, MIoD, FBDIGCC, is an environmental engineer with a double master's in both sciences and business administration, Waddah has published widely as an Industrial Academic. He is respected as a leading authority on health, safety, environmental and sustainability governance, and leadership, and is also the chairman of the Platform for Connected Leadership. His interest in cultural competence is deeply rooted in his views on the importance of creating a dialogue amongst civilisations, rejoicing in what connects humankind, rather than what differentiates it.
